Kulick stays on top as star-studded quintet set for stepladder finals of U.S. Women’s Open
The star-studded quintent for the stepladder finals of the U.S. Women's Open: Kelly Kulick, Missy Parkin, Shannon O'Keefe, Stephanie Nation and Lynda Barnes. Photo by United States Bowling Congress.
Kelly Kulick lengthened her lead to an astounding 425 pins as she earned the top seed for the stepladder finals of the U.S. Women’s Open, which will be taped Wednesday at 9 p.m. Central time and shown Tuesday at 7 p.m. on ESPN2, the United States Bowling Congress reported. But when Kulick starts the title match on the championships lanes outside in downtown Reno her huge lead will mean nothing: she and whoever advances from the star-studded field to meet her will both start with zero....
